3、When driving on a mountain road covered by ice and snow, the vehicle behind should ______ if the vehicle in front is climbing a slope.
A. Climb slowly
B. Closely follow and climb
C. Select a proper place to stop and climb after the vehicle in front has passed
D. Rapidly overtake the vehicle in front
Answer:C

5、If a motorized vehicle driver causes a traffic accident and runs away but his conduct does not constitute a crime, he is subject to a 12-point penalty.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
6、When a vehicle changes lane, the driver only needs to turn on the turn signal before rapidly entering the new lane.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B
7、Before a vehicle enters an intersection, the driver should reduce speed, observe and make sure it is safe to do so.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
8、When driving at night, the driver should go at a lower speed because his field of vision is limited and he can hardly observe the traffic conditions beyond the area covered by his vehicle light.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
9、What to do besides controlling speed less than 20km/hr when the visibility is lower than 50 meters on the expressway?
A. run in the emergency lane
B. leave the expressway as soon as possible
C. stop by the roadside as soon as possible
D. run slowly in the road shoulder
Answer:B
10、Pass the crossing as fast as possible if there is a red light at the intersection of a road or a level crossing.

A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B
11、When a motorized vehicle runs on an expressway, it ________.
A. May stop on the road shoulder to let passengers on and off
B. May stop in the emergency lane to load and unload cargos
C. May overtake or stop in the acceleration or deceleration lane
D. Is not allowed to drive or stop in the emergency lane in a non-emergency case
Answer:D
12、What is the main role of the seat belt when there is a collision?
A. to protect the driver and passengers necks
B. to protect the driver and passengers chests
C. to reduce the injuries of the driver and passengers
D. to protect the driver and passengers waists
Answer:C
13、Traffic Signs and traffic markings are not traffic signals.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B
14、One who runs away after causing a traffic accident and constitute a crime can not apply for motorized vehicle driving license.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
15、For a driver who drivers a commercial motor vehicle after drinking, besides being detained by the traffic management department of the public security organ till he/she sobers up, what will he/she be subject to?
A. Temporary detainment of the motor vehicle
B. Temporary detainment of the driving license
C. Revocation of the motor vehicle driving license
D. He/she will be banned from driving for life
Answer:C

17、When a vehicle passes a bumped road, the driver should ________.
A. Speed up and dash over under inertia
B. Change to the neutral gear and slide over
C. Maintain the original speed and pass
D. Pass slowly and steadily
Answer:D
18、If a motorized vehicle driver escapes after causing a major traffic accident which has caused human death, the driver is subject to a prison term of ________.
A. more than 7 years
B. less than 3 years
C. 3 ~ 7 years
D. more than 10 years
Answer:C

20、What is the role of ABS system when applying emergency braking?

A. cut off the power output
B. control the direction automatically
C. reduce braking inertia
D. prevent wheel blocking
Answer:D
